World of Warcraft just released a new bundle on Battle.net that includes two Valentine’s Day-themed broom mounts, alongside 600 Trader’s Tender. Fans can collect extra currency for the Trading Post in World of Warcraft by buying this controversial $30 bundle from now through March 31.

The Trading Post is a collection feature where players can collect Trader’s Tender by completing in-game tasks on the Traveler’s Log, which can then be exchanged for various cosmetics, toys, and mounts. February marks the two-year anniversary of the Trading Post in World of Warcraft, meaning fans can pick up an extra 500 Trader’s Tender to spend at a number of special vendors offering popular items from past catalogs at impressive discounts.

That said, players who need a little more Trader’s Tender can get some via the cash shop. The Enchanted Sweeper Bundle is a $30 offer on Battle.net and the in-game store that includes two mounts: the purple and black Twilight Witch’s Sweeper and the blue Sky Witch’s Sweeper, both of which match former cash shop transmogs of the same name. However, fans who buy this bundle will also earn 600 Trader’s Tender for use at the Trading Post.

This is not the first time World of Warcraft has offered Trader’s Tender in exchange for real money. Players get 500 Trader’s Tender for purchasing The War Within, but can earn up to 500 more by purchasing the Epic Edition, or half as much for the Heroic Edition. Additionally, the limited-time Corsage Pack and High Scholar’s Pack cash shop bundles also awarded 200 and 500 Trader’s Tender respectively – but at $5 and $25 each, the new Enchanted Sweeper Bundle is the largest Trader’s Tender microtransaction to date.

Needless to say, fans aren’t happy about this new bundle. While the Twilight and Sky Witch Sweeper mounts themselves are popular, few are pleased to see the Trading Post receive further monetization. Players have found it especially predatory that the extra vendors for the Trading Post’s two-year anniversary in World of Warcraft provide tons of cheap items to spend Trader’s Tender on right now, further tempting fans into buying this bundle.

The Twilight or Sky Witch’s Sweeper mounts may come to the Trading Post in the future, but not until at least July. Until then, players have two options for alternative recolors: The pink Love Witch’s Sweeper and the red Silvermoon Sweeper. The former is a new drop from the Love is In the Air instanced encounter in World of Warcraft for 2025, while the latter is available at the Trading Post for 600 Trader’s Tender. While the Enchanted Sweeper Bundle gives fans exactly enough to pick up this mount, players can also use the 750 Trader’s Tender available via the Plunderstorm Plunderstore if they have not already done so during the event’s first run.
